+# `ArrayLike<X>`: array-like objects that can be coerced into `X`
+# given the casting rules `same_kind`
+_ArrayLikeBool = _ArrayLike[
+ "dtype[bool_]",
+ bool,
+]
+_ArrayLikeUInt = _ArrayLike[
+ "dtype[Union[bool_, unsignedinteger[Any]]]",
+ bool,
+]
+_ArrayLikeInt = _ArrayLike[
+ "dtype[Union[bool_, integer[Any]]]",
+ Union[bool, int],
+]
+_ArrayLikeFloat = _ArrayLike[
+ "dtype[Union[bool_, integer[Any], floating[Any]]]",
+ Union[bool, int, float],
+]
+_ArrayLikeComplex = _ArrayLike[
+ "dtype[Union[bool_, integer[Any], floating[Any], complexfloating[Any, Any]]]",
+ Union[bool, int, float, complex],
+]
+_ArrayLikeTD64 = _ArrayLike[
+ "dtype[Union[bool_, integer[Any], timedelta64]]",
+ Union[bool, int],
+]
+_ArrayLikeDT64 = _NestedSequence[_SupportsArray["dtype[datetime64]"]]
+_ArrayLikeObject = _NestedSequence[_SupportsArray["dtype[object_]"]]
+
+_ArrayLikeVoid = _NestedSequence[_SupportsArray["dtype[void]"]]
+_ArrayLikeStr = _ArrayLike[
+ "dtype[str_]",
+ str,
+]
+_ArrayLikeBytes = _ArrayLike[
+ "dtype[bytes_]",
+ bytes,
]
